Социальные платформы разработка

APPTASK
0 Комментарии
Время чтения: 7 минут(ы)
Статья отправлена на e-mail

Оглавление

Социальные платформы оказали значительное влияние на наше общество, трансформировав способ общения и взаимодействия пользователей. В последние десятилетия мы стали свидетелями бурного роста таких сервисов, которые позволяют людям со всего мира соединяться, обмениваться информацией и строить сообщества. Разработка социальных платформ становится все более актуальной задачей для программистов и дизайнеров.

Тем не менее, создание успешной социальной платформы требует не только технических навыков, но и глубокого понимания человеческой психологии и социальных взаимодействий. Для того чтобы привлечь и удержать пользователей, важно учитывать их потребности, предпочтения и ожидания. В этом контексте разработка должна быть ориентирована на пользователя, обеспечивая комфортный и интуитивно понятный интерфейс.

Кроме того, с увеличением числа пользователей возрастают и риски, связанные с безопасностью данных, а также вопросами конфиденциальности. Создание устойчивой и безопасной платформы - это еще одна важная задача для разработчиков. Поэтому в процессе разработки социальных платформ необходимо учитывать многие аспекты, включая технологии, правила и этические нормы.

Социальные платформы: Разработка, Практические Советы и Будущее Индустрии

Социальные платформы стали неотъемлемой частью нашей повседневной жизни. Они позволяют людям взаимодействовать друг с другом, обмениваться информацией и даже вести бизнес. Создание социальной платформы — это многогранный процесс, который включает в себя множество аспектов от разработки и проектирования до маркетинга и поддержки пользователей. В этой статье мы рассмотрим ключевые этапы разработки социальных платформ, лучшие практики и связанные с этим вызовы.

Разработка социальных платформ включает в себя несколько ключевых этапов и требует внимания ко многим аспектам, чтобы гарантировать их успешное функционирование и удовлетворение потребностей пользователей.

На начальном этапе важно определить цель платформы. Будете ли вы создавать сеть для профессионалов, где пользователи могут обмениваться опытом и находить работу, или же это будет развлекательный проект для общего общения? Четкое понимание целевой аудитории и ее потребностей поможет вам спроектировать интерфейс, который удобен и интуитивно понятен.

Следующий этап — это проектирование пользовательского интерфейса (UI) и пользовательского опыта (UX). Дизайн платформы должен быть привлекательным и функциональным, обеспечивая легкий доступ ко всем возможностям и услугам. Интуитивное управление и доступность информации — это ключевые факторы успеха любой социальной сети.

Техническая реализация платформы включает в себя выбор технологий и инструментов для разработки. На этом этапе необходимо определиться с языками программирования, фреймворками и базами данных. Современные технологии, такие как React или Vue.js для фронтенда и Node.js или Django для бэкенда, часто используются для создания масштабируемых и высокопроизводительных приложений.

Важно предусмотреть, что платформа должна уметь обрабатывать большое количество запросов и пользователей одновременно. Оптимизация серверной части и использование облачных решений могут значительно повысить производительность социальной сети.

Безопасность данных пользователей — это один из самых приоритетных аспектов при разработке любой социальной платформы. Использование современных методов шифрования и мониторинга позволяет защитить данные пользователей и сохранить их конфиденциальность. Регулярные обновления и аудит безопасности — это важные меры для предотвращения утечек данных.

После того как основная часть платформы разработана, следует этап тестирования. Это должен быть комплексный процесс, который включает в себя как функциональное, так и нефункциональное тестирование. Тестирование помогает обнаружить баги, оценить производительность и обеспечить безопасность платформы перед ее запуском.

Запуск платформы — это только начало. Необходимо обеспечить поддержку пользователей, реагируя на их отзывы и пожелания. Постоянное улучшение и обновление функционала — это ключевые факторы для удержания пользователей и привлечения новых. Разработка приложения для мобильных устройств также станет важным шагом в расширении аудитории, поскольку большинство пользователей предпочитают использовать мобильные устройства для доступа к социальным сетям.

Марткетинг и привлечение пользователей — это другой важный аспект успешной социальной платформы. Создание контента, привлекающего целевую аудиторию, работа с социальными сетями и SEO-оптимизация — это всего лишь некоторые из методов продвижения вашей платформы.

Социальные платформы также могут генерировать доход через разные бизнес-модели. Одним из самых распространенных способов является внедрение рекламы. Вы можете продавать рекламу третьим лицам или использовать партнерские программы для увеличения дохода. Но важно помнить, что чрезмерное количество рекламы может негативно сказаться на пользовательском опыте.

Социальные платформы находятся в постоянном развитии, поэтому для их успешной разработки необходимо следить за трендами и изменениями в индустрии. Искусственный интеллект и машинное обучение уже стали важными инструментами для анализа данных пользователей и улучшения взаимодействия с ними. Понимание потребностей пользователей и адаптация платформы под их запросы помогут вам оставаться конкурентоспособным на рынке.

Таким образом, разработка социальной платформы — это многогранный процесс, требующий внимания к множеству деталей. Успешная платформа должна быть функциональной, безопасной и удобной для пользователей. Регулярное обновление и улучшение, а также грамотный маркетинг будут способствовать ее развитию и привлечению пользователей. Только так можно гарантировать, что ваша платформа станет успешной и востребованной в мире социальных сетей.

Помимо всех упомянутых аспектов, стоит отметить важность анализа и мониторинга активности пользователей на платформе. Это позволит вам понять, какие функции наиболее востребованы, а какие не используются, что, в свою очередь, поможет в дальнейшем развитии и улучшении платформы.

Существует множество инструментов для аналитики, таких как Google Analytics, Mixpanel, которые могут помочь вам собрать необходимую информацию о поведении пользователей. Это, в свою очередь, позволит принимать обоснованные решения и стратегически развивать вашу платформу.

Ключевым фактором успешности социальной платформы является создание сообщества пользователей. Участие пользователей в обсуждениях, создание групп по интересам, возможность обмена контентом — все это создает активное сообщество, которое будет возвращаться на платформу снова и снова.

Не забывайте о важности привлечения партнеров и сотрудничества с другими компаниями. Это поможет вам расширить вашу аудиторию и предложить пользователям новые возможности. Например, интеграция с популярными сервисами и приложениями может значительно повысить ценность вашей платформы и привлечь новых пользователей.

Часто социальные платформы сталкиваются с проблемами, связанными с негативным контентом. Безопасность платформы включает в себя модерацию пользовательского контента, чтобы обеспечить положительный опыт для всех пользователей. Разработка эффективных алгоритмов и системы модерации помогут в борьбе с нежелательным контентом и обеспечат комфортное взаимодействие на платформе.

Важно также учитывать особенности различных культур и социальных групп, что позволит вам расширить свою аудиторию. Локализация платформы, включая перевод интерфейса и адаптацию контента, может значительно повысить популярность и востребованность вашей социальной платформы в разных регионах.

Следует отметить, что будущее социальных платформ будет связано с внедрением новых технологий. Виртуальная и дополненная реальность, искусственный интеллект и блокчейн открывают новые горизонты для развития социальных сетей. Интеграция этих технологий может создать революционные изменения в том, как пользователи взаимодействуют друг с другом.

Еще одной важной тенденцией является появление децентрализованных социальных платформ, которые нацелены на усиление контроля пользователей над своими данными и контентом. Это может привести к новой эпохе в предоставлении и использовании социальных сетей, с большей защитой и свободой для самовыражения пользователей.

Наконец, нельзя забывать о социальных и этических аспектах разработки платформ. Создание комфортного и безопасного пространства для пользователей должно быть приоритетом для любого разработчика. Этические стандарты и внимание к вопросам приватности станут определяющими для успеха и доверия пользователей к вашей платформе.

В заключение, разработка социальных платформ — это сложный, многогранный процесс, который требует детального анализа, внимания к деталям и готовности адаптироваться к быстроменяющимся условиям рынка. Следуя наилучшим практикам, учитывая потребности пользователей и будущем внедрении технологий, вы сможете построить успешную и востребованную социальную платформу.

Работа над проектом социальной сети может потребовать значительных усилий и ресурсов, но при наличии правильной стратегии, четкого понимания рынка и актуальных данных о пользователях вы сможете создать платформу, которая не только привлечет внимание, но и удержит пользователей, предложив им уникальный и полезный опыт взаимодействия.

Надеемся, что эта статья предоставила вам полезную информацию о процессе разработки социальных платформ, связанных с ним вызовах и возможностях. Вперёд к созданию успешных проектов в мире социальных сетей!

Социальные сети – это новые места, где мы встречаемся, обмениваемся идеями и создаём отношения.

— Тому Уолш

Платформа Язык программирования Основные особенности
Facebook PHP, JavaScript Социальная сеть с множеством функций и API для разработчиков.
Twitter Java, Scala Платформа для микроблоггинга с ограничением на количество символов.
Instagram Python, JavaScript Социальная сеть для обмена фото и видео.
LinkedIn Java, JavaScript Профессиональная сеть для установления деловых контактов.
Reddit Python Социальная платформа для обмена новостями и обсуждениями.
TikTok Java, Swift Платформа для создания и просмотра коротких видео.

Основные проблемы по теме "Социальные платформы разработка"

Проблемы с безопасностью данных

Одной из самых серьезных проблем, с которыми сталкиваются социальные платформы, является безопасность данных пользователей. В эпоху цифровизации и распространения информации риски, связанные с утечками данных, становятся все более актуальными. Хакеры и злоумышленники активно ищут уязвимости в системах, что может привести к массовым утечкам личной информации. Владельцы платформ должны внедрять многоуровневые механизмы защиты, регулярные обновления и мониторинг безопасности, чтобы минимизировать риски. Кроме того, сложные данные требуют соблюдения законодательств, таких как GDPR, что добавляет дополнительные сложности для разработчиков и администраторов платформ. Эффективная защита данных требует не только технических решений, но и повышения осведомленности пользователей о рисках.

Проблема модерации контента

Современные социальные платформы сталкиваются с серьезными вызовами, связанными с модерацией контента. Быстрый рост пользовательской базы приводит к увеличению объемов генерируемого контента, что затрудняет контроль за его качеством и соответствием правилам платформы. Неприменение адекватных мер модерации может привести к распространению ненадлежащего, оскорбительного или опасного контента, что негативно сказывается на репутации платформы. Поэтому разработчики должны интегрировать мощные алгоритмы, использующие машинное обучение и искусственный интеллект для автоматического определения неприемлемого контента. Однако полностью автоматическая модерация пока недоступна, и необходима команда человеков для ручной проверки, что требует значительных затрат ресурсов.

Проблема взаимодействия с пользователями

Взаимодействие с пользователями — ключевой аспект функционирования социальных платформ. Наиболее актуальной проблемой становится создание эффективных инструментов для общения и обмена мнениями. Пользователи ожидают быстрого реагирования от разработчиков на свои запросы и предложения, а также прозрачности в управлении платформой. Неудовлетворенность пользователей высока, когда их комментарии и обсуждения теряются в потоке информации. Эффективное взаимодействие требует внедрения систем обратной связи, поддержки пользователей и обновления функционала платформы в соответствии с их потребностями. Кроме того, важно разрабатывать интуитивно понятные интерфейсы и проводить обучающие мероприятия для пользователей, что требует постоянного внимания со стороны команды разработчиков.

Что такое социальные платформы?

Социальные платформы – это онлайн-сервисы, позволяющие пользователям взаимодействовать, обмениваться контентом и строить социальные связи.

Какие технологии используются для разработки социальных платформ?

Для разработки социальных платформ обычно используются языки программирования, такие как JavaScript, Python и PHP, а также фреймворки, базы данных и API для интеграции различных функций.

Как обеспечить безопасность пользователей на социальной платформе?

Обеспечение безопасности пользователей возможно через аутентификацию, шифрование данных, регулярные обновления системы и мониторинг активности для предотвращения мошенничества.

Будь в курсе наших новостей,
подписывайся!
Автор
APPTASK

Почти готово!

Завершите установку, нажав на загруженный файл
ниже и выполнив инструкции.

Примечание. Если загрузка не началась автоматически, нажмите здесь.

Щелкните этот файл, что бы начать установку Apptask

#